adjective
- superlative form of innocent; most free from guilt, wrongdoing, or evil intent
- superlative form of innocent; most naive, unsuspecting, or lacking in worldly knowledge
Usage: archaic or poetic superlative; modern English typically uses 'most innocent' instead
